Output 66c2d6397c9563fa42e46e99f2fe0cc390e3c148069a91f106d20098aa35576e:1

value
11355000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 faf44a51182a43cb49a28063c9ed453fcc553774 OP_EQUALVERIFY OP_CHECKSIG
address
DU227oZj8zDX9wjgs3o2zLTbMZwbrZ7GAC
transaction
66c2d6397c9563fa42e46e99f2fe0cc390e3c148069a91f106d20098aa35576e